Does Bloodborne run better on a PS5?
You can run Bloodborne on the PlayStation 5, as an ordinary PlayStation 4 game, and this does help speed up the loading times, which were one of the big problems. Why is Bloodborne locked at 30FPS?
Digital Foundry reveals that FromSoftware codes a 30FPS cap into all of its games on PS4, but unfortunately it's this cap that generates the stuttering on the console.
